Skip to main content
Announcements
Have questions about Qlik Connect? Join us live on April 10th, at 11 AM ET: SIGN UP NOW
cancel
Showing results for 
Search instead for 
Did you mean: 
marcelvinicius
Creator III
Creator III

Zerar as horas realizadas

Boa tarde Comunidade,

Gostaria de ajuda com o seguinte:

Tenho uma tabela de cartão ponto do funcionário ao qual tenho dias trabalhados, horas programadas e horas realizadas.

E outra tabela que possui os atestados por dia e o dia inicio do mesmo.

Gostaria de saber se tem como ZERAR as horas realizadas de um funcionário, caso o dia do atestado seja igual ao dia de trabalho.

Obs.: E se também pode ser ZERADO os dias seguintes referente a quantidade de dias de atestado;

Exemplo: Tenho na tabela CartaoPonto 20 trabalhados no mês de Agosto do Funcionário JOAO. Na tabela ATESTADOS eu tenho 1 dia de inicio de atestados (10/08/2017) e 3 dias de atestado. Quero ZERAR as horas realizadas desses 3 dias.

Obs.: 2 - Monto isso no momento da carga (vide abaixo) ou consigo montar na tabela de apresentação do APP?

CartaoPonto.png

Atestados.png

2 Replies
fmbrancher
Creator
Creator

Bom dia Marcel, para a primeira dúvida tente fazer uma condição IF

Se o dia de trabalho for igual a data de incio do atestado, as horas realizadas serão igual a 0, se não serão igual as horas realizadas.

IF (DIATRABALHO=DtInicAtestado,HorasRealizada='0',HorasRealizada)

Podes montar na hora da apresentação mesmo criando a função quando for gera a tabela ou o grafico.

marcelvinicius
Creator III
Creator III
Author

Bom dia Felipe, como vai?

Não funcionou, tens alguma outra ideia?

Atenciosamente.